Tobacco rattle virus (TRV), a member of the Tobravirus genus, is a soil-borne plant virus affecting a wide range of crops, including potato and tobacco. It can cause characteristic symptoms such as ring spots, mottling, and tuber necrosis. Early and accurate molecular detection is essential for disease surveillance and effective crop management.
